Scrub Football Finals Today.

NO WRITER ATTRIBUTED

In the final game of the scrub football series, the Climbers will play the Skin and Bones team at 4 o'clock this afternoon on the north field of Soldiers Field.

The Climbers won the series last year, but only four men who played on the team then will play today. Both the Climbers and the Skin and Bones team, however, are strong, and the game this afternoon should be close. The members of the winning team will receive cups offered by Mr. P. V. Bacon '98.
